Since this is a rather important update, I figure I may as well make a new post so people see it.

Got 3 more (click to view the full size versions):

Image
^Didn't jjgp say that this one couldn't be done? Wasn't a problem at all, and any aura brightness discrepancies between frames were resolved with the "replace color" option in Photoshop.

Image
^Believe it or not, this one actually gave me more trouble. I really wanted the entire frame so that I could laugh at the hair, but the last frame had a different animation frame than the first and the rest I took, so the aura didn't match up and I had to splice the very tip onto the below frame using selective erasing, and thankfully it turned out nearly perfect!
